Output 66bacc3a3d63ba02898e8070eb09ea29973578b40c2dc3d7226b4e4146ec1c26:1

value
1516952
script pubkey
OP_0 OP_PUSHBYTES_20 d98cccb6bc3401308d0861faa31d774ee2a2371d
address
ltc1qmxxved4uxsqnprggv8a2x8thfm32ydcaqxtjcj
transaction
66bacc3a3d63ba02898e8070eb09ea29973578b40c2dc3d7226b4e4146ec1c26
spent
true